Pheon Therapeutics | Senior Clinical Trial Manager/Associate Director
__________________________________________________________________________________
Responsibilities
Pheon’s Senior Clinical Trial Manager/Associate Director will collaborate with Pheon’s Head of
Development Operations and Sciences to provide key operational oversight and support of all clinical trial
activities including vendor oversight and management, from study initiation to closure.
Lead Clinical Operations activities for one or more of Pheon’s clinical stage programs.
Contribute to early and late phase clinical development strategy.
Be accountable for implementing clinical development strategy by planning for and execution on
early and late phase clinical projects.
Work independently, provide input into and oversee development of clinical plans, study plans,
and clinical documents (synopses, protocols, ICFs, IBs and CSRs)
Proactively manage and oversee sites, CROs, and all other study-related vendors to ensure trial
deliverables and performance goals are met and high level of operational excellence is
maintained
Plan and lead site start-up, directing both Pheon-led and CRO-led start-up activities
Manage studies within agreed timelines and budget
Manage compliance and quality of a clinical trial, including maintaining accurate documentation
of trial progress
Oversee set-up, technical integrations, and maintenance of clinical systems such as databases,
eTMF, central reading, central/specialty labs, and other trial execution and/or data collection
platforms
Ensure all trials are conducted according to relevant ICH/GCP guidelines and applicable local
regulations
Qualifications
The successful candidate will have clinical operations experience in oncology and in early phase
drug development.
Bachelors Degree in a technical discipline, e.g., life sciences, engineering, etc., preferred.
Strong people and project management skills
Has served as an operational expert in clinical trial activities, including site start-up activities
Minimum of 8 years of clinical operations experience in a pharmaceutical or biotech or CRO
setting, including a minimum of 3 years of experience in managing clinical trial vendors
Prior site experience strongly preferred
Demonstrated leadership skills and ability to lead, direct and support cross-functional teams
Strong interpersonal, organizational, and multi-tasking skills
Excellent knowledge and understanding of ICH/GCP and EU Guidelines for conducting clinical
trials, and have inspection experience
